Why UK Electricians Trust Our Calculators
Built to meet the real demands of site work — not to tick boxes, but to help you do the job right.
We Show the Working
No "black box" calculations. Every result includes the methodology—see the correction factors (Ca, Cg, Ci) applied, the tables referenced, and the formula used.
If a cable recommendation "looks wrong", you can see exactly why and sanity-check the inputs.
Explicit BS 7671 References
Results reference specific regulation numbers and tables—Table 4D5 for T&E, Table 54.7 for earthing conductors, Regulation 612.11 for PFC. Cross-reference with your own copy.
Updated for BS 7671:2018+A2:2022 (Amendment 2) requirements.
Clear Pass/Fail Indicators
Traffic light compliance status at a glance. Green for compliant, amber for borderline (approaching limits), red for non-compliant—with specific reasons shown.
"Voltage drop exceeds 3% (11.5V)" is actionable. "Error" is not.
Built for Site Use
Large touch targets for gloved hands. High-contrast interfaces readable in bright sunlight or dark plant rooms. Dropdowns and toggles instead of fiddly typing.
No login walls. Works instantly in any browser.
Real Installation Methods
We don't ask vague questions like "Is it in a wall?" We ask for the specific reference method—Method 100 vs 101 vs 102/103. Because a cable in thermal insulation isn't the same as clipped to a joist.
Current capacity can drop 50%+ depending on installation—we model this correctly.
